Output 8c76fa9cd3b2960621f7e09d0358b4017a4f6c7405c42a02a50f0bf6a5908830:2

value
15373000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8e497224a935130d2a55444e677401bc7ad693e OP_EQUALVERIFY OP_CHECKSIG
address
1KKDz6zFam2uRdnn8zhsEWYK8XHdeh5txE
transaction
8c76fa9cd3b2960621f7e09d0358b4017a4f6c7405c42a02a50f0bf6a5908830
spent
true